# Troubleshooting ## Ready stays unavailable 1. Confirm Postgres: `make logs` / Compose health. 2. Run `make db-migrate`. 3. Hit `/health/ready` again. Workers may retry until migrations catch up after a late migrate. ## Unexpected HTTP 501 Declared methods on majors **6–9** should have handlers. If you see 501: - Confirm the active runtime (`/api2/json/version` and Web UI runtime label). - Confirm you are calling the path/verb exactly as declared for that major. - Check `CONTRACT_FALLBACK` is not masking a different issue with fixture mode. - Report a regression — full registry coverage is expected. ## 401 / 403 - Ticket expired or cookie not sent. - Mutation missing `CSRFPreventionToken` on a ticket session. - API token malformed (`PVEAPIToken=user@realm!id=secret`). - ACL denial (try `auditor@pve` vs `root@pam` to compare). ## Task never finishes - Inspect `/nodes/{node}/tasks/{upid}/status` and `/log`. - Check worker logs (`make logs`). - Verify `TASK_WORKER_CONCURRENCY` > 0 and database leases can be claimed. - Extremely high `SIMULATION_TIME_SCALE` slowdowns are unusual (higher = faster simulation); mis-set worker leases are more common culprits. ## proxmoxer / TLS failures - Use host port **8007** (gateway), not 8006, for TLS clients. - Set `verify_ssl=False` **only** for the local self-signed cert. - Inside Compose, target `tls-gateway:8443`. - Seeded node name for `small` is `pve01`, not `pve1`. ## Terraform / Pulumi drift after reseed Reseed replaces PostgreSQL guests; tool state files do not. Refresh, import, or rebuild stacks after `make seed`. ## Hot-swap “did nothing” - Catalog browse ≠ apply. Use **Apply as runtime** or `POST /ui/api/contract/apply?major=N`. - Confirm with `/api2/json/version`. - Remember apply is process-local; Compose restart restores `CONTRACT_SNAPSHOT`. ## Demo unload surprised you `POST /ui/api/demo/unload` clears API-created state and loads `minimal`. Re-run `make seed PROFILE=small` (or load demo again) to restore richer fixtures.
